diff --git a/src/site/_includes/components/searchScript.njk b/src/site/_includes/components/searchScript.njk index d75a9d7..367da67 100644 --- a/src/site/_includes/components/searchScript.njk +++ b/src/site/_includes/components/searchScript.njk @@ -111,10 +111,11 @@ } }); + const debouncedSearch = debounce(search, 250, false); field = document.querySelector('#term'); field.addEventListener('keydown', (e) => { if (e.key !== 'ArrowDown' && e.key !== 'ArrowUp') { - debounce(search, 500, false)(); + debouncedSearch(); } }); resultsDiv = document.querySelector('#search-results'); @@ -144,12 +145,12 @@ resultsDiv.innerHTML = resultsHTML; return; } - resultsHTML += ''; + resultsHTML += ''; resultsDiv.innerHTML = resultsHTML; } \ No newline at end of file diff --git a/src/site/styles/digital-garden-base.scss b/src/site/styles/digital-garden-base.scss index 411a821..44e43b4 100644 --- a/src/site/styles/digital-garden-base.scss +++ b/src/site/styles/digital-garden-base.scss @@ -292,11 +292,6 @@ ul.task-list { max-height: 50vh; } -#search-results ul { - padding-inline-start: 0; - width: 100%; -} - #search-results .searchresult { margin-bottom: 15px; list-style: none; @@ -306,10 +301,6 @@ ul.task-list { font-size: 1.2rem; cursor: pointer; - &:hover { - border: 2px solid var(--text-accent); - } - &.active{ border: 2px solid var(--text-accent); } @@ -329,7 +320,7 @@ ul.task-list { .search-link { display: block; margin-bottom: 4px; - font-size: 1.2rem; + font-size: 1.4rem; } .search-button {